diff options
-rw-r--r-- | .SRCINFO | 8 | ||||
-rw-r--r-- | PKGBUILD | 29 |
2 files changed, 17 insertions, 20 deletions
@@ -1,8 +1,8 @@ pkgbase = gnome-todo-git pkgdesc = Simple to-do list manager for Gnome - pkgver = 245.6581252 + pkgver = 3.91.1+448+g34ddbcc pkgrel = 1 - url = https://feaneron.wordpress.com/2015/06/22/introducing-gnome-to-do/ + url = https://wiki.gnome.org/Apps/Todo install = gnome-todo.install arch = i686 arch = x86_64 @@ -12,8 +12,8 @@ pkgbase = gnome-todo-git makedepends = intltool depends = gtk3 depends = evolution-data-server-git - source = git+git://git.gnome.org/gnome-todo - sha256sums = SKIP + source = git+https://gitlab.gnome.org/GNOME/gnome-todo.git + sha512sums = SKIP pkgname = gnome-todo-git @@ -1,30 +1,27 @@ -# Maintainer: Alex Palaistras <alex+archlinux<at>deuill.org> - pkgname=gnome-todo-git -pkgver=245.6581252 +_pkgname=gnome-todo +pkgver=3.91.1+448+g34ddbcc pkgrel=1 pkgdesc="Simple to-do list manager for Gnome" arch=('i686' 'x86_64') -url="https://feaneron.wordpress.com/2015/06/22/introducing-gnome-to-do/" +url="https://wiki.gnome.org/Apps/Todo" license=(GPL) depends=('gtk3' 'evolution-data-server-git') makedepends=('git' 'gnome-common' 'intltool') install=gnome-todo.install -source=('git+git://git.gnome.org/gnome-todo') -sha256sums=('SKIP') +source=('git+https://gitlab.gnome.org/GNOME/gnome-todo.git') +sha512sums=('SKIP') -build() { - cd "$srcdir"/gnome-todo - ./autogen.sh --prefix=/usr --sysconfdir=/etc --localstatedir=/var --disable-schemas-compile - make +pkgver() { + cd $_pkgname + git describe --tags | sed 's/-/+/g' } -package() { - cd "$srcdir"/gnome-todo - make DESTDIR="$pkgdir" install +build() { + arch-meson $_pkgname build + ninja -C build } -pkgver() { - cd "$srcdir"/gnome-todo - echo $(git rev-list --count master).$(git rev-parse --short master) +package() { + DESTDIR="$pkgdir" ninja -C build install } |